So I had some more time today, I restored my test x96 mini box back to android, then downloaded the current jammy 23.02 build: Armbian_23.02.2_Aml-s9xx-box_jammy_current_6.1.11.img.xz, installed it onto sd card using balenea, copied u-boot-s905x-s912 -> u-boot.ext, edited the extlinux.conf to use: FDT /dtb/amlogic/meson-gxl-s905w-p281.dtb

Inserted the sd card, pressed and held reset button, plugged in power, waited about 2 seconds, released the reset button and it booted into Armbian jammy.

 

So it works for me.  Things to check for: are you sure you are using a quality sd card? Are you sure you have properly copied the u-boot.ext?

While I don't think it would be an issue with the android firmware you are using, especially as you have tried different ones, the one I am using (don't know where I got it, as I downloaded it years ago) is of size: 1,566,582,416

Okay, wild thing: I've tried to poke UART with jumper wire with a help of my friend, who plugged/unplugged power on my command. We did that without HDMI cable connected. I finally was able to see serial port logs and guess what... it booted! 

 

At first I've thought that I haven't waited long enough for it to boot. I've attached HDMI cable back, rebooted and... same black screen. I've detached HDMI thinking of asking friend to do power thing again. I thought maybe I've shorted something around while I was poking UART. I've plugged power back and went for a friend.

 

Accidentally I left ping pinging IP of the box and when I was back... host was responding to ICMP. And I was able to SSH into the host, I've attached HDMI back and voila: I had terminal on a screen. I've installed Armbian on emmc using `install-aml.sh` script and without USB stick it behaved the same: if HDMI is plugged there is no output after boot. 

I've tried to verify my findings on another brand new box. My steps:

  • Plugged USB stick with 
  • Plugged network cable
  • Held reset button
  • Plugged power
  • Waited about 2-5 seconds and released reset button
  • Waited until box acquired IP over DHCP
  • Plugged HDMI cable
  • Got terminal output on screen

I suppose there is some bug in video initialization at early stages of boot (u-boot?) that breaks HDMI when cable plugged in. Is there a place I can report it? I contribute boot logs over UART with cable both plugged and unplugged.

If HDMI cable plugged in on power-on there is no video signal at all. If HDMI cable is not plugged in on power-on and attached 30 seconds later, there is video signal and everything work as expected.

Temporary workaround is to add 

 

drm_kms_helper.edid_firmware=HDMI-A-1:edid/1920x1080.bin video=HDMI-A-1:1920x1080-24@60

 

at the end of `append` in  `extlinux.conf`. 

Video signal now appears after kernel initializes

Pure chance, some random knowledge about HDMI protocol and some googling around 🙂

 

If video output works with other distributions on the same hardware, then it's most likely not a hardware issue. Since it works when OS booted without HDMI and @AlexanderTN said that it worked with FHD display and failed on 2K and my display is 4k and it didn't work, then it might be related to resolution. HDMI-equipped output devices have a feature to exchange information about supported video modes: EDID. So my hypothesis was when HDMI is plugged on boot, then it negotiates resolution that is not supported by GPU. And x96mini support max of FHD. 

I've googled is there a way to force linux kernel to use specific resolution regardless of what EDID presented and boom: there is an `drm_kms_helper.edid_firmware` option exactly for that.
